Output 30a5ef3133bde40ff05d7589fc9458e0c35cac18a2f23bbfc60a5ece6e48daf4:50

value
16409
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 877e3d283b74b27bd0e58ae6fa77b089380b08c6 OP_EQUALVERIFY OP_CHECKSIG
address
1DMRT8W1CkoJw5G5gxPXMCZTkTaqTFfb84
transaction
30a5ef3133bde40ff05d7589fc9458e0c35cac18a2f23bbfc60a5ece6e48daf4
spent
true